To balance things out a bit on this forum I have started this post, my best personal IQ features are:

1) 70 + MPG (on my 1.0ltr Manual)

2) 5 star N Cap safety

3) 9 Air bags

4) Ease of driving IE "Drivability"

5) Great "Turning Circle"

6) Low running costs in general

7) Zero UK Road tax on the 1.0ltr manual

8) Low insurance costs (mine is less than £140 Pounds Sterling PA)

9) Parking ability

10) Unique design

£20 tax, I thought the 1.0 were zero tax?

I pay £30 as the race driver in me came out so had to buy the 1.3. :driving:

Craig.

110 g/km emissions on 1.0L multidrive so £20

99 g/km emissions on 1.0L manual so £0

I've only had the car for 2 weeks. For me, its best features so far are...

Zero road tax

The turning circle

The 'fun factor' feeling I get when I drive it - it's like a go-kart with a roof.

The fuel economy - 50mpg from a 14-year-old car isn't bad.

The ease of working on it.
